IL-10 Recombinant Rat produced in
Escherichia coli is a single, glycosylated polypeptide chain containing 160 amino acids and having a molecular mass of 18.6 kDa. The Interleukin-10 Mouse is purified by proprietary chromatographic techniques.
Synonyms: B-TCGF, CSIF, TGIF, IL-10, IL10A, MGC126450, MGC126451, Cytokine synthesis inhibitory factor.
Formulation: The protein was lyophilized containing 20mM Tris-HCl pH-8 and 100mM NaCl.
Physical Appearance: Sterile Filtered White lyophilized (freeze-dried) powder.
Purity: Greater than 97% as determined by: (a) Analysis by RP-HPLC. (b) Analysis by SDS-PAGE.
Solubility: It is recommended to reconstitute the lyophilized IL-10 in sterile 18MΩ-cm H2O not less than 100 µg/ml, which can then be further diluted to other aqueous solutions.
Stability: Lyophilized IL-10 Rat although stable at room temperature for 3 weeks, should be stored desiccated below -18°C. Upon reconstitution Interleukin10 should be stored at +4°C between 2-7 days and for future use below -18°C. For long term storage it is recommended to add a carrier protein (0.1% HSA or BSA). Please prevent freeze-thaw cycles.
Biological Activity: The ED50 as determined by the dose dependent inhibition of MC/9 proliferation is less than 10ng/ml concentration corresponding to a Specific Activity of 100,000 IU/mg.
